Challenges with Differentiable Quantum Dynamics

Abstract

Differentiable quantum dynamics require automatic differentiation of a complex-valued initial value problem, which numerically integrates a system of ordinary differential equations from a specified initial condition, as well as the eigendecomposition of a matrix. We explored several automatic differentiation frameworks for these tasks, finding that no framework natively supports our application requirements. We therefore demonstrate a need for broader support of complex-valued, differentiable numerical integration in scientific computing libraries.
